Wiley, Richard Haven was born on May 10, 1913 in Mattoon, Illinois, United States. Son of John Frederick and Mary Frances (Moss) Wiley.
Bachelor of Arts, Univercity Illinois, 1934; Master of Sciences, University Illinois, 1935; Doctor of Philosophy, University Wisconsin, 1937; Bachelor of Laws, Temple University, 1943.
Fellow Wisconsin Alumni Research Foundation, 1935-1937. Research chemist E.I. duPont de Nemours & Company, Wilmington, Delaware, 1937-1945. Associate professor chemistry University North Carolina, 1945-1949.
Professor chemistry, chairman department University Louisville, 1949-1965. National Science Foundation senior postdoctoral fellow Imperial College, London, 1957-1958. Visiting professor graduate division City University of New York, 1963-1964, executive officer chemistry, 1965-1968.
Professor chemistry Hunter College, 1965-1979, professor emeritus, from 1979. Visiting scholar Stanford University, 1978-1980. Volunteer employee San Jose State University, 1980-1985.
Fellow American Association for the Advancement of Science, American Institute Chemists, New York Academy of Sciences. Member American Chemical Society (Midwest award St. Louis section 1965), New York Academy of Sciences, Phi Beta Kappa, Sigma Xi, Phi Eta Sigma, Phi Lambda Upsilon, Phi Kappa Psi.
Married Marybeth Signaigo, December 28, 1940. Children: Richard Haven, Frank Edmund.
